Founded in 1961, the company is one of the few in the field that both develops and manufactures its own technology: cabinets, drivers, software and most electronics. We pride ourselves on our technical excellence and innovation, producing many patents and papers over the years.
KEF shares its research facility with its sister company, Celestion International, a leader in the field of OEM drive units for guitar and PA. This allows both brands to benefit from advanced tools and technologies that are the envy of rivals around the world.
